Understanding the Core Mechanics of Aviator

Aviator’s core mechanic revolves around a random number generator (RNG) that determines when the plane will crash. There’s no guaranteed winning strategy, reinforcing the need for informed betting and risk management. It’s crucial to remember that each round is independent, meaning past results don’t influence future outcomes. Focusing on statistical analysis, and observing patterns, is the primary goal. The excitement emanates from the increasing multiplier, representing the potential payoff – however, bigger multipliers come with greater risk.

The game thrives on creating a sense of anticipation with its easy-to-understand format. Players need to decide if they’ll cash out early for a smaller, safer win, or hold on for a larger multiplier, risking the loss of their initial bet. This dynamic creates a compelling cycle. There are two options when it comes to the cash-out settings: Auto Cashout and Manual Cashout. Auto Cashout allows players to predefine a multiplier at which their bet will automatically be cashed out. The manual option requires players to be vigilant. The Limitations of Prediction and the Importance of Risk Management

Despite the allure of a reliable predictor aviator, it’s crucial to understand its limitations. The game fundamentally relies on Random Number Generation (RNG), rendering perfect prediction impossible. Any predictor can, at best, provide probabilities and suggest optimal betting strategies, but it cannot eliminate the inherent risk. It is wise to be skeptical of any tool claiming guaranteed wins, and remember to approach the game for entertainment rather than a source of income.

Effective risk management is paramount. Setting a budget and sticking to it, defining loss limits, and knowing when to walk away are all crucial elements of responsible gameplay. Diversifying betting strategies, and avoiding large single bets, can further minimize risk. Prioritizing preservation of capital, and never chasing losses, are vital for a sustainable and enjoyable gaming experience.
